For me brain fog was the most distressing symptom of menopause that seemed to strike out of the blue.
At first I didn’t even realise it was menopause-related and couldn’t work out what was happening to me!
I suddenly found myself unable to think clearly and function at work like I used to and even simple tasks seemed beyond me in my senior corporate marketing role. I felt like I was really messing up and making a fool of myself.
I took myself off to the doctors, only to be offered antidepressants, which seemed crazy as I knew I wasn’t depressed….. but had no idea what else to do.
However, after changing my diet, including more green leafy veg; phytooestrogens such as flaxseeds, edamame beans and chickpeas; prioritising my sleep ensuring I got 7-8 hours a night; plus working on managing my stress levels through daily meditation and weekly yoga sessions; I started to feel less foggy and be able to think more clearly.
